Nominations for Committees for the Municipal Year 2021/22

Meeting: 17/05/2021 - Civic Affairs (Item 14)

14 Nominations for Committees for the Municipal Year 2021/22 pdf icon PDF 249 KB

Minutes:

The Committee considered a paper setting out the proposed Committee allocations by party and the nominations received. The Committee considered the rules on political balance set out in the Local Government and Housing Act 1989 in developing the recommendations set out below.

 

The Committee noted the proposed committees and nominations set out in the paper issued on 17 May.  The Democratic Services Manager stated that the Council on 27 May would be considering a Notice of Motion to propose that the four area committees will continue to meet virtually until the end of 2021 and by meeting virtually, they will be non-decision making.  

 

Resolved (unanimously) to:

 

i.               Recommend to Council to agree the number and size of committees and to note the nominations listed below (any updates will be provided in the Information Pack to Council):
